Holy Family Parent Teacher Organizati0n includes all parents of children registered in school. Much of the success of the school is due to the wonderful support and aid given by this organization. The PTO meetings are a very important form of commitment and it is, therefore, required that at least one parent attend each of the three meetings listed below. These meetings are for parents, not children. They are listed in advance so that you can arrange for childcare. One service hour per family is earned by attending the general meetings. For each meeting missed there is a $50.00 fee.

The financial support of the PTO helps to keep down tuition costs and maintains a mutual spirit of cooperation between home and school in the interest of the children.

Each family is required to pay the $50.00 PTO dues. This amount is due July 14, 2023. A separate check is to be written payable to Holy Family Parent Teacher Organization.
